Biden Grants Clemency to Leonard Peltier, Indigenous Activist
In a significant act of clemency during his final days in office, President Biden commuted the life sentence of Leonard Peltier, an Indigenous activist convicted in the 1975 killings of two FBI agents. Peltier, who has spent nearly 50 years in prison, will now serve his sentence in home confinement, allowing him to receive necessary medical care. His case has long been a focal point for advocates who argue he was wrongfully convicted due to prosecutorial misconduct and systemic injustices against Indigenous peoples. The decision received mixed reactions, with supporters celebrating the move as a long-overdue measure of justice, while critics, including Virginia's Attorney General, expressed disappointment. Meanwhile, Ferrone Claiborne and Terance Richardson, charged in a separate case involving the murder of a police officer over 20 years ago, were also granted clemency by Biden, stirring further controversy over his clemency decisions. The contrasting responses to these cases highlight ongoing tensions surrounding issues of justice and racial equity in the U.S.
